Who Writes MNteractive?
Mostly me these days ![]()
But that’s not the idea.
There are 22 contributors listed in the sidebar with many more registered authors. Everyone with a MNteractive.com login fits the following criteria; live in Minnesota, works in the loosely defined software interface design community. There are Flash people (Jake), and non-Flash people (me), usability people (dirtgrl), copywriters (Stephanie), visual designers (Mark), information architects (Terralee, Samantha, Fred, Cody), agency owners (lolife, sevnthsin), and those that cross all those labels (Darrel).
I didn’t pick these people…well not all of them ;). They picked MNteractive. I asked some people early on, and I still ask anyone that I’d like to hear from. But, a good chunk of the people are self-selected. Just the way I want it. Registration to the site is open to anyone. Yes. Wide open.
